•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

VBA regel splitsen

  • Onderwerp starter Onderwerp starter Roma
  • Startdatum Startdatum
Status
Niet open voor verdere reacties.

Roma

Gebruiker
Lid geworden
7 sep 2013
Berichten
515
beste allemaal,

Ik heb een vba regel en die wil ik graag over 2 regels hebben
Hoe moet ik dat doen?
Alvast bedankt


Code:
If WorksheetFunction.Or(Sh.Name = "NLC 1", Sh.Name = "1", Sh.Name = "NLC 2", Sh.Name = "2", Sh.Name = "NLC 3", Sh.Name = "3", Sh.Name = "NLC 4", Sh.Name = "4") Then
 
Or is in VBA ingebouwd, dus je hoeft WOrksheetfunction niet te gebruiken. Je splitst een regel door te eindigen met spatie gevolgd door underscore gevolgd door enter:

Code:
    If Sh.Name = "NLC 1" Or Sh.Name = "1" Or Sh.Name = "NLC 2" Or Sh.Name = "2" Or _
        Sh.Name = "NLC 3" Or Sh.Name = "3" Or Sh.Name = "NLC 4" Or Sh.Name = "4" Then
 
Alternatief:

Code:
    Select Case Sh.Name 
    Case "NLC 1", "1", "NLC 2", "2", "NLC 3", "3", "NLC 4", "4"
    Case Else
    End Select
 
of
Code:
if instr("NLC 1234",left(sh.name,4)) then

regel afbreken lijkt me niet nodig ;)
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an